Transaction 8e598934682e70fb6a8fd19e4b6e3341f29f16fc953c14578b3779e5accc5e8a

1 Input
2 Outputs
  • 8e598934682e70fb6a8fd19e4b6e3341f29f16fc953c14578b3779e5accc5e8a:0
  • value  1393146
    address  3GRXb9MGzY7i7LNUa7dsHhDzLD3ytGEAxY
  • 8e598934682e70fb6a8fd19e4b6e3341f29f16fc953c14578b3779e5accc5e8a:1
  • value  1139943
    address  32HmztCTzPMfnUsZmCm7brzo6PpxC1YwS4